Tantalus V was the site of a Federation penal colony and asylum. In 2207 the asylum was run by Dr. Tristan Adams. That year, Adams' associate, Dr. Simon van Gelder, discovered that Adams had been experimenting on patients with his neural neutralizer device. Adams used the neural neutralizer on van Gelder — which caused him to appear to have multiple psychoses — and committed him to the asylum. On Stardate 2715.1, van Gelder escaped to the U.S.S. Enterprise NCC-1701, and the truth of Adams' behavior was finally exposed, though Adams died during the incident.[1]
